I have so many photos to process from this year that I'm wildly jumping from folder to folder to work on the cooler stuff. Here's a Tamaulipan Rock Rattlesnake (Crotalus morulus) from Nuevo León, Mexico a few weeks ago. Kicking off the pumpkin spice season.

A small brown rattlesnake with darker blotches, coiled in some dead leaves
